Dry well installation services involve setting up underground drainage systems designed to manage excess water runoff. These systems typically consist of a perforated pipe surrounded by gravel or other aggregate materials, which allows water to seep into the surrounding soil gradually. The installation process includes excavating the designated area, placing the dry well components, and ensuring proper connections to existing drainage infrastructure. This service helps facilitate effective water management for properties that experience heavy rainfall or have poor natural drainage.

One of the primary issues dry well installation addresses is flooding caused by inadequate drainage. When excess water cannot drain properly, it can lead to pooling, soil erosion, and potential damage to foundations and landscaping. Installing a dry well provides an underground outlet for this water, reducing surface runoff and preventing water accumulation around structures. This solution is especially useful in areas prone to standing water after storms, helping to protect property integrity and maintain a safer environment.

Material and Permitting Costs - The cost for materials and permits typically ranges from $300 to $1,200 depending on local requirements and project scope. Higher-quality materials and complex permits can increase expenses. Variations are common based on project specifics.

Labor and Installation Fees - Labor costs for dry well installation usually fall between $1,000 and $3,500. Factors influencing costs include site accessibility and the complexity of the installation process. Local pros may charge more for difficult terrain or additional work.

Additional Site Preparation - Site preparation expenses, such as excavation or grading, can add $200 to $1,000 to the overall project. The extent of preparation needed depends on soil conditions and existing landscape features. Variations depend on project size and site conditions.

Overall Project Cost - Total costs for dry well installation services generally range from $1,500 to $5,000. Exact pricing depends on project size, materials used, and local labor rates. Contact local service providers for specific estimates tailored to individual need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a dry well used for? A dry well helps manage excess water by directing it into the ground, reducing surface pooling and preventing flooding around properties.

How long does a dry well installation typically take? The installation duration varies depending on site conditions and system size, but local service providers can provide an estimated timeframe.

What types of locations are suitable for dry well installation? Dry wells can be installed in residential yards, gardens, or other outdoor areas where water runoff needs to be managed effectively.

Are there any permits required for installing a dry well? Permit requirements depend on local regulations; contacting local contractors can help determine if permits are necessary in Rochester, WA, or nearby areas.

What maintenance is needed for a dry well? Maintenance generally involves periodic inspection and removal of debris to ensure proper water flow, which local pros can assist with.
